
Bill Russell tops this list without a doubt. Drafted in 1956 by the St Louis Hawks after Sihugo Green, Russell annihilated the league. He has 11 championships with the Boston Celtics in 13 seasons. He is a five time MVP with 12 all star appearances and career averaged... 22.5 rebounds per game.
Russell's 51 rebounds in a single game is the second highest performance ever, only trailing Wilt Chamberlain's all-time record of 55.
Russell is universally seen as one of the best NBA players ever.
